Introduction
Encorafenib, a potent BRAF kinase inhibitor, has gained prominence as a targeted therapy in treating metastatic melanoma harboring BRAF V600 mutations. As with many advanced pharmaceuticals, the reliable sourcing of bulk active pharmaceutical ingredients (APIs) is pivotal for pharmaceutical manufacturers, ensuring consistency, regulatory compliance, and supply chain robustness. This review explores the global landscape of encorafenib bulk API sources, emphasizing manufacturing hubs, supplier credibility, quality standards, and market trends shaping the API procurement strategy.
Understanding Encopharenib's API Market Dynamics
Encorafenib's strategic importance stems from its selective inhibition of the mutated BRAF V600E/K kinases, a mutation prevalent in approximately 50% of melanomas. Its clinical efficacy hinges on high-purity, well-characterized API supplies that meet stringent standards set by regulatory agencies such as the FDA and EMA. The API supply chain for encorafenib is relatively concentrated owing to its complex synthesis pathways, proprietary manufacturing processes, and limited commercialization window.

Quality and Regulatory Compliance
Suppliers of encorafenib API must adhere to Good Manufacturing Practices (GMP), with certifications from authorities such as the FDA, EMA, or PMDA. The rarity of encorafenib's API manufacturing process underscores the importance of validated processes, rigorous quality control, and batch-to-batch consistency. Suppliers are typically required to submit detailed analytical, stability, and process validation data as part of regulatory submissions.
Market Trends and Sourcing Challenges
- Limited Number of Suppliers: The proprietary synthesis route limits the number of capable manufacturers, creating supply bottlenecks and dependency risks.
- Supply Chain Consolidation: Major pharma companies prefer vertically integrated or licensed sources to ensure process control and regulatory compliance.
- Pricing and Cost Factors: Due to complexity and limited competition, encorafenib API costs are high, influencing pricing strategies.
- Geopolitical Factors: Trade policies, tariffs, and regional manufacturing regulations impact sourcing options, especially with potential supply from China or India.
- Supply Security: Manufacturing capacity expansions, crisis management (e.g., COVID-19 disruptions), and strategic stockpiling are increasingly crucial.
